A writer would choose to introduce a direct quotation with a colon in order toadd emphasis. Option C.

Quotations are usually introduced with terms like he whispered, she claimed, and They shouted. Such an introduction can be followed by a comma or a colon in order to separate it from the quotation,

In more formal writing that punctuation is expected after an introduction for a quotation.
